Policeman sentenced to two years of custodial restraint for shooting at drunken Krasnodar resident

The verdict against Andrei Scherba, the ex-staff member of the private security department of the Krasnodar UVD (Interior Department), who was found guilty of causing death by negligence because of improper execution of his professional duties (Part 2 of Article 109 of the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ation), has come into force. This was reported by Natalia Smyatskaya, Assistant Director of the Investigatory Department of the Investigatory Committee of the Russian Federation (ICRF) in the Krasnodar Territory.

The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that at night of May 20, 2011, the staff member of the private security department of the Krasnodar UVD shot and killed a drunken driver while checking his documents. People in a car reacted aggressively on the request to present the documents, and a conflict arose. The driver attacked the policeman, and at the time of the fight, the policeman made an involuntary shot to the head of the attacker.

The trial took place in the second half of April; however, the verdict has come into force on the other days. This was told by Natalia Smyatskaya to the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ent.

"The court sentenced Andrei Scherba to two years of custodial restraint and deprived him of the right to hold positions in the law enforcement agencies for the same period. His recognizance not to leave will continue to be valid," Natalia Smyatskaya clarified.

  • Activist Larisa Bochieva released from SIZO

    The Supreme Court (SC) of Dagestan has overturned the decision to extend the arrest of Larisa Bochieva, accused of creating a cell of an extremist organization. This was reported by Shamil Khadulaev, the chairman of the Dagestani Public Oversight Commission (POC) in his Telegram channel.

  • Defendant in case on pogrom at Makhachkala airport pleads not guilty

    Magomednabi Shaikhslamov, involved as a defendant in a case on pogrom at an airport in Makhachkala, claimed that he ended up at the scene of the riots by accident, since he worked as a taxi driver. The video shows Magomednabi Shaikhslamov approaching the police, talking to them and leaving, but investigators accused the man of using violence against a public official.
